5 Compeigne Avenue, Riddlesden, Keighley, BD21 4EU is a freehold terraced property built before 1900. The property offers approximately 732 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£125,910 , which equates to approximately £172 per square foot. It was last sold on 28 May 2021 for £99,950. Since then, the value has increased by £25,960, representing a 26.0% increase, or approximately 5.7% per year.

The current estimated value of £125,910 is:

  • 19.4% lower than the average property price on Compeigne Avenue
  • 11.6% lower than the average in the BD21 4EU postcode area
  • and 30.9% lower than the average price for Keighley as a whole

This property has had 2 EPC inspections with recorded tenure information. It was recorded as owner-occupied both times. This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 16 February 2021,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

EPC Summary

5 Compeigne Avenue, Riddlesden, Keighley, Bradford, West Yorkshire, BD21 4EU has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 16 Feb 2021.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 1 Apr 2016, when the property was rated G. Since then, the rating has improved to D,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 320%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The heating system was upgraded from portable electric heaters assumed for most rooms to boiler and radiators, mains gas, improving energy efficiency from very poor to good.
  • The hot water system was changed from electric immersion, off-peak to from main system, with its energy efficiency improving from very poor to good.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 200 mm loft insulation to pitched, 75 mm loft insulation, changing energy efficiency from good to average.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in all f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 63% of fixed outlets, with efficiency changing from very good to good.
